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Problem locating files on Windows #685

Closed
danrubel opened this issue Dec 5, 2011 · 6 comments
Closed

Problem locating files on Windows #685

danrubel opened this issue Dec 5, 2011 · 6 comments
Assignees

Comments

@danrubel
Copy link

danrubel commented Dec 5, 2011

!ENTRY com.google.dart.indexer 4 0 2011-12-04 15:15:16.562
!MESSAGE Unexpected Exception
!STACK 0
com.google.dart.indexer.workspace.index.TargetIndexingFailed: Failed to index file (retry): file:/C:/Dart/dart/samples/total/src/Reader.dart
       at com.google.dart.indexer.workspace.index.WorkspaceIndexer.indexTarget(WorkspaceIndexer.java:481)
       at com.google.dart.indexer.workspace.index.WorkspaceIndexer.doIndexPendingFiles(WorkspaceIndexer.java:436)
       at com.google.dart.indexer.workspace.index.WorkspaceIndexer.indexPendingFiles(WorkspaceIndexer.java:235)
       at com.google.dart.indexer.workspace.driver.WorkspaceIndexingDriver$IndexingJob.run(WorkspaceIndexingDriver.java:60)
       at org.eclipse.core.internal.jobs.Worker.run(Worker.java:54)
Caused by: java.lang.IllegalArgumentException
       at org.eclipse.core.internal.resources.WorkspaceRoot.findFilesForLocationURI(WorkspaceRoot.java:112)
       at org.eclipse.core.internal.resources.WorkspaceRoot.findFilesForLocationURI(WorkspaceRoot.java:104)
       at com.google.dart.tools.core.internal.util.ResourceUtil.getResources(ResourceUtil.java:123)
       at com.google.dart.tools.core.internal.model.DartProjectImpl.findFileForUri(DartProjectImpl.java:776)
       at com.google.dart.tools.core.internal.model.DartProjectImpl.getHandleFromMemento(DartProjectImpl.java:705)
       at com.google.dart.tools.core.internal.model.DartElementImpl.getHandleFromMemento(DartElementImpl.java:318)
       at com.google.dart.tools.core.internal.model.DartModelImpl.getHandleFromMemento(DartModelImpl.java:293)
       at com.google.dart.tools.core.internal.model.DartElementImpl.getHandleFromMemento(DartElementImpl.java:318)
       at com.google.dart.tools.core.DartCore.create(DartCore.java:264)
       at com.google.dart.tools.core.DartCore.create(DartCore.java:240)
       at com.google.dart.tools.core.internal.indexer.location.DartElementLocationType.byUniqueIdentifier(DartElementLocationType.java:75)
       at com.google.dart.indexer.locations.LocationPersitence.byUniqueIdentifier(LocationPersitence.java:76)
       at com.google.dart.indexer.storage.paged.LocationTreeStore.fromPath(LocationTreeStore.java:444)
       at com.google.dart.indexer.storage.paged.LocationTreeStore.locationFromId(LocationTreeStore.java:198)
       at com.google.dart.indexer.storage.paged.FileTreeStore.decode(FileTreeStore.java:303)
       at com.google.dart.indexer.storage.paged.FileTreeStore.read(FileTreeStore.java:181)
       at com.google.dart.indexer.storage.paged.DiskMappedStorage.readFileInfo(DiskMappedStorage.java:230)
       at com.google.dart.indexer.storage.GenericFileTransaction.<init>(GenericFileTransaction.java:73)
       at com.google.dart.indexer.storage.GenericStorageTransaction.createFileTransaction(GenericStorageTransaction.java:111)
       at com.google.dart.indexer.index.IndexTransaction.indexTarget(IndexTransaction.java:108)
       at com.google.dart.indexer.workspace.index.WorkspaceIndexer.indexTarget(WorkspaceIndexer.java:475)
       ... 4 more
!SESSION 2011-12-05 01:21:36.880 -----------------------------------------------
eclipse.buildId=unknown
java.version=1.7.0_01
java.vendor=Oracle Corporation
BootLoader constants: OS=win32, ARCH=x86_64, WS=win32, NL=en_US
Command-line arguments: -os win32 -ws win32 -arch x86_64 -data workspace

!ENTRY org.eclipse.core.jobs 4 2 2011-12-05 01:21:54.703
!MESSAGE An internal error occurred during: "Dart Editor Initialization".
!STACK 0
java.lang.IllegalArgumentException
       at org.eclipse.core.internal.resources.WorkspaceRoot.findFilesForLocationURI(WorkspaceRoot.java:112)
       at org.eclipse.core.internal.resources.WorkspaceRoot.findFilesForLocationURI(WorkspaceRoot.java:104)
       at com.google.dart.tools.core.internal.util.ResourceUtil.getResources(ResourceUtil.java:123)
       at com.google.dart.tools.core.internal.model.DartProjectImpl.findFileForUri(DartProjectImpl.java:776)
       at com.google.dart.tools.core.internal.model.DartProjectImpl.getHandleFromMemento(DartProjectImpl.java:705)
       at com.google.dart.tools.core.internal.model.DartElementImpl.getHandleFromMemento(DartElementImpl.java:318)
       at com.google.dart.tools.core.internal.model.DartModelImpl.getHandleFromMemento(DartModelImpl.java:293)
       at com.google.dart.tools.core.internal.model.DartElementImpl.getHandleFromMemento(DartElementImpl.java:318)
       at com.google.dart.tools.core.DartCore.create(DartCore.java:264)
       at com.google.dart.tools.core.DartCore.create(DartCore.java:240)
       at com.google.dart.tools.core.internal.indexer.location.DartElementLocationType.byUniqueIdentifier(DartElementLocationType.java:75)
       at com.google.dart.indexer.locations.LocationPersitence.byUniqueIdentifier(LocationPersitence.java:76)
       at com.google.dart.indexer.storage.paged.LocationTreeStore.fromPath(LocationTreeStore.java:444)
       at com.google.dart.indexer.storage.paged.LocationTreeStore.locationFromId(LocationTreeStore.java:198)
       at com.google.dart.indexer.storage.paged.LocationTreeStore.decodeLocation(LocationTreeStore.java:409)
       at com.google.dart.indexer.storage.paged.LocationTreeStore.decode(LocationTreeStore.java:371)
       at com.google.dart.indexer.storage.paged.LocationTreeStore.read(LocationTreeStore.java:236)
       at com.google.dart.indexer.storage.paged.DiskMappedStorage.readLocationInfo(DiskMappedStorage.java:256)
       at com.google.dart.indexer.index.readonly.DiskBackedIndexImpl.getLocationInfo(DiskBackedIndexImpl.java:78)
       at com.google.dart.indexer.index.layers.reverse_edges.ReverseEdgesQuery.executeUsing(ReverseEdgesQuery.java:42)
       at com.google.dart.indexer.workspace.index.WorkspaceIndexer.execute(WorkspaceIndexer.java:158)
       at com.google.dart.indexer.workspace.driver.WorkspaceIndexingDriver.execute(WorkspaceIndexingDriver.java:182)
       at com.google.dart.tools.core.indexer.DartIndexer.getAllTypes(DartIndexer.java:165)
       at com.google.dart.tools.core.indexer.DartIndexer.warmUpIndexer(DartIndexer.java:838)
       at com.google.dart.tools.ui.DartUIStartup$StartupJob.indexerWarmup(DartUIStartup.java:87)
       at com.google.dart.tools.ui.DartUIStartup$StartupJob.run(DartUIStartup.java:50)
       at org.eclipse.core.internal.jobs.Worker.run(Worker.java:54)

@danrubel
Copy link
Author

danrubel commented Dec 5, 2011

////////////////////////////////////////////////////////////////////////////////////
Editor Version: 1910
OS: Windows 7
////////////////////////////////////////////////////////////////////////////////////

@danrubel
Copy link
Author

danrubel commented Dec 5, 2011

!ENTRY com.google.dart.indexer 4 0 2011-12-04 14:34:42.227
!MESSAGE Unexpected Exception
!STACK 0
com.google.dart.indexer.workspace.index.TargetIndexingFailed: Failed to index file (retry): file:/C:/Users/Saskia%20Bakker/dart/Test1/Test1.dart
       at com.google.dart.indexer.workspace.index.WorkspaceIndexer.indexTarget(WorkspaceIndexer.java:481)
       at com.google.dart.indexer.workspace.index.WorkspaceIndexer.doIndexPendingFiles(WorkspaceIndexer.java:436)
       at com.google.dart.indexer.workspace.index.WorkspaceIndexer.indexPendingFiles(WorkspaceIndexer.java:235)
       at com.google.dart.indexer.workspace.driver.WorkspaceIndexingDriver$IndexingJob.run(WorkspaceIndexingDriver.java:60)
       at org.eclipse.core.internal.jobs.Worker.run(Worker.java:54)
Caused by: java.lang.IllegalArgumentException
       at org.eclipse.core.internal.resources.WorkspaceRoot.findFilesForLocationURI(WorkspaceRoot.java:112)
       at org.eclipse.core.internal.resources.WorkspaceRoot.findFilesForLocationURI(WorkspaceRoot.java:104)
       at com.google.dart.tools.core.internal.util.ResourceUtil.getResources(ResourceUtil.java:123)
       at com.google.dart.tools.core.internal.model.DartProjectImpl.findFileForUri(DartProjectImpl.java:776)
       at com.google.dart.tools.core.internal.model.DartProjectImpl.getHandleFromMemento(DartProjectImpl.java:705)
       at com.google.dart.tools.core.internal.model.DartElementImpl.getHandleFromMemento(DartElementImpl.java:318)
       at com.google.dart.tools.core.internal.model.DartModelImpl.getHandleFromMemento(DartModelImpl.java:293)
       at com.google.dart.tools.core.internal.model.DartElementImpl.getHandleFromMemento(DartElementImpl.java:318)
       at com.google.dart.tools.core.DartCore.create(DartCore.java:264)
       at com.google.dart.tools.core.DartCore.create(DartCore.java:240)
       at com.google.dart.tools.core.internal.indexer.location.DartElementLocationType.byUniqueIdentifier(DartElementLocationType.java:75)
       at com.google.dart.indexer.locations.LocationPersitence.byUniqueIdentifier(LocationPersitence.java:76)
       at com.google.dart.indexer.storage.paged.LocationTreeStore.fromPath(LocationTreeStore.java:444)
       at com.google.dart.indexer.storage.paged.LocationTreeStore.locationFromId(LocationTreeStore.java:198)
       at com.google.dart.indexer.storage.paged.LocationTreeStore.decodeLocation(LocationTreeStore.java:409)
       at com.google.dart.indexer.storage.paged.LocationTreeStore.decode(LocationTreeStore.java:371)
       at com.google.dart.indexer.storage.paged.LocationTreeStore.read(LocationTreeStore.java:236)
       at com.google.dart.indexer.storage.paged.DiskMappedStorage.readLocationInfo(DiskMappedStorage.java:256)
       at com.google.dart.indexer.storage.GenericStorageTransaction.removeStaleLocationsFromDestination(GenericStorageTransaction.java:171)
       at com.google.dart.indexer.index.IndexTransaction.removeStaleInformationAboutLocations(IndexTransaction.java:273)
       at com.google.dart.indexer.index.IndexTransaction.removeInformationThatWillBeReconstructed(IndexTransaction.java:239)
       at com.google.dart.indexer.index.IndexTransaction.removeInformationThatWillBeReconstructed(IndexTransaction.java:223)
       at com.google.dart.indexer.index.IndexTransaction.indexTarget(IndexTransaction.java:109)
       at com.google.dart.indexer.workspace.index.WorkspaceIndexer.indexTarget(WorkspaceIndexer.java:475)
       ... 4 more

@bwilkerson
Copy link
Member

Set owner to @bwilkerson.

@bwilkerson
Copy link
Member

Please verify whether this has been fixed.


Set owner to @devoncarew.

@DartBot
Copy link

DartBot commented Dec 16, 2011

This comment was originally written by functional...@gmail.com


On the same build I seem to have even worse problems: at the start of the
Dart editor:
An internal error occurred during: "Dart Editor Initialization".
java.lang.IllegalArgumentException

A rebuild and a subsequent attempt to run it gives the same problems. I
have sent feedback with details.

@devoncarew
Copy link
Member

No longer seeing this on Windows-


Added Done label.

copybara-service bot pushed a commit that referenced this issue Aug 21, 2023
… webdev

Revisions updated by `dart tools/rev_sdk_deps.dart`.

collection (https://github.com/dart-lang/collection/compare/1ed009e..1a9b7eb):
  1a9b7eb  2023-08-15  ebraminio  Minor typo fix (#304)

dartdoc (https://github.com/dart-lang/dartdoc/compare/5cfb1f3..e148373):
  e1483735  2023-08-14  Parker Lougheed  Adjust links to dart.dev class modifier documentation (#3476)

http (https://github.com/dart-lang/http/compare/9f167a7..631d4ec):
  631d4ec  2023-08-18  Alex James  Add java_http .gitattributes file (#999)
  58a5462  2023-08-17  Alex James  JavaClient can stream the HTTP response body (#1005)
  df1f625  2023-08-15  Brian Quinlan  Add some additional header tests (#1006)

mockito (https://github.com/dart-lang/mockito/compare/ff79de6..e54a006):
  e54a006  2023-08-18  Copybara-Service  Merge pull request #685 from LuisDuarte1:feature/build-extensions
  5f3a4ca  2023-08-18  Luís Duarte  Format files
  2d4ec1e  2023-08-17  Luís Duarte  Update lib/src/builder.dart
  bc06f9f  2023-08-17  Luís Duarte  Make builder not merge generic extension.
  af043a0  2023-08-16  Luís Duarte  Replace double-quotes with single quotes
  034e6c1  2023-08-16  Luís Duarte  Update lib/src/builder.dart
  4ff995f  2023-08-10  Luís Duarte  Make MockBuilder support build_extensions option.

protobuf (https://github.com/dart-lang/protobuf/compare/a852ba4..5e8f36b):
  5e8f36b  2023-08-16  Ömer Sinan Ağacan  Add dart2wasm targets to benchmark builder (#806)
  41d0156  2023-08-15  Ömer Sinan Ağacan  Document why we add '$' prefix to result local in constructors (#870)
  41193fd  2023-08-14  Devon Carew  Rename a local variable to avoid proto field name conflicts, re-generate protos (#869)

test (https://github.com/dart-lang/test/compare/bc0a992..d0fc4bd):
  d0fc4bde  2023-08-16  Nate Bosch  Extend the timeout for runtime_matrix_test (#2084)
  cdf80280  2023-08-16  Nate Bosch  Add some console logging to browser test startup (#2083)
  6146c292  2023-08-16  Nate Bosch  Add an ignore for an SDK deprecation (#2082)
  27142079  2023-08-15  Parker Lougheed  Fix improperly rendered changelog entry (#2081)
  46cf4de0  2023-08-15  Nate Bosch  Timeout browser suite loads (#2080)

tools (https://github.com/dart-lang/tools/compare/295ff92..2be6c2e):
  2be6c2e  2023-08-16  Ben Konyi  Added `dartCliCommandExecuted` and `pubGet` events (#123)

webdev (https://github.com/dart-lang/webdev/compare/19aad27..fc876cb):
  fc876cb0  2023-08-16  Elliott Brooks  Reset Webdev to 3.0.8-wip (#2197)
  1aa7c523  2023-08-16  Elliott Brooks  Prepare webdev for release to 3.0.7 (#2196)

Change-Id: Idc228d0f3f70f5b3e7bfc6e777260dfe84fe96f5
Reviewed-on: https://dart-review.googlesource.com/c/sdk/+/322060
Commit-Queue: Devon Carew <devoncarew@google.com>
Reviewed-by: Nate Bosch <nbosch@google.com>
This issue was closed.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

5 participants